Output 80bba4416babe14893160f72f87dc7ccaec2a22e7c39ca172ea20609cfb8c249:1

value
577131
script pubkey
OP_0 OP_PUSHBYTES_20 81dbff8bedd44cda402256db57014fa00222ec3c
address
bc1qs8dllzld63xd5spz2md4wq205qpz9mpuhc2rzq
transaction
80bba4416babe14893160f72f87dc7ccaec2a22e7c39ca172ea20609cfb8c249
spent
true